## What is the Asset of Collateral Redistribution?

Collateral redistribution, within cryptocurrency and derivatives, represents a dynamic re-allocation of assets serving as margin or security for open positions. This process is fundamentally driven by shifts in market volatility, counterparty credit risk, and the maintenance of solvency for centralized exchanges or decentralized protocols. Effective redistribution mitigates systemic risk by ensuring sufficient collateral buffers exist to cover potential losses, particularly during periods of extreme price fluctuations or cascading liquidations. The mechanism often involves automated margin calls, forced liquidations, and the dynamic adjustment of collateralization ratios based on real-time market data and risk models.

## What is the Adjustment of Collateral Redistribution?

The adjustment component of collateral redistribution is critical for maintaining the stability of derivatives markets, especially those involving perpetual swaps or leveraged tokens. Exchanges and protocols employ sophisticated algorithms to monitor portfolio risk and trigger collateral adjustments when necessary, impacting traders through margin requirements or position sizing. These adjustments are not merely reactive; proactive adjustments based on predictive analytics and order book dynamics are increasingly utilized to anticipate and prevent potential imbalances. Consequently, understanding the parameters governing these adjustments is paramount for effective risk management and trading strategy development.

## What is the Algorithm of Collateral Redistribution?

An algorithm governs the core functionality of collateral redistribution, automating the process of assessing risk and reallocating assets. These algorithms typically incorporate factors such as position size, leverage ratio, mark price, funding rates, and volatility indices to determine the appropriate level of collateral required. Sophisticated implementations utilize machine learning techniques to refine risk assessments and optimize collateral allocation, adapting to evolving market conditions and trading behaviors. The transparency and efficiency of these algorithms are vital for fostering trust and ensuring fair market practices within the decentralized finance ecosystem.
